Austin, William, M.A., Peterhouse, Camb., 1845 (7th wrangler 1842), chairman Metropolitan and St. John's Wood Railway Co., diiector of various railway and other public companies, a student of Lincoln's Inn 16 Feb., 1842 (then aged 21), called to the bar 1 May, 1846 (only son of Edward Austin, Esq., of Ellern Croft, Wootton-under-Edge); born 17 March, 1820; married 1st, 12 March, 1863, Mary Ann Jane, eldest dau. of Francis William Topham, Esq., of Hampstead; she died 21 May, 1868; he married 2ndly, 19 July, 1873, Gertrude Jane, only dau. of William C. T. Dobson, Esq., R.A.
- Ellern Mede, Totteridge, Herts.
